1. Manduka eKO Superlite Travel Yoga Mat
Highlights:
Travel Companion
- Material– Eco-Friendly rubber
- Thickness– 1.5 millimeters
- Dimensions– 64⨯24⨯0.06
- Weight– 2.2 pounds
Description:
Manduka Eko Superlite travel yoga mat is the best mat for traveling. The mat is light, flexible, compact, easily foldable, and weighs just 2.2 pounds, making it your perfect companion for yoga while traveling. Made of superior materials, the mat is fairly durable and can last some abuse.
The mat is easy to fold into a case. Also, it is sticky. So if you practice yoga on hardwood, expect it to be completely static. The mat provides an excellent grip and is made up of 100% natural rubber.
Pros:
- Easily foldable
- Lightweight
- Sticky
- Perfect for traveling
Cons:
- Very thin
- Not sticky on carpets
2. LIFORME Original Yoga Mat
Highlights:
- Material– Rubber
- Thickness– 0.17 Inches
- Dimensions– 72.83 x 26.77 x 0.17 inches
- Weight– 2.5 Kilograms
Description:
Original Yoga Mat by Liforme is one of the best yoga mats for practice at home. It has ‘grip for me’ technology that provides you with an excellent grip while practicing yoga. Also, the ‘align for me’ technology offers ideal alignment for yogis of all experience levels.
The product is also eco-friendly as it is made from biodegradable materials and contains no PVC or toxic materials.
The mat is also quick-drying. So if you sweat a lot during yoga, this is the mat for you. The length and breadth of the mat are larger than the usual standard size, which makes it perfect for taller yogis. The thickness of 0.17 inches provides ample cushion and great comfort.
Pros
- Has guided marks
- Comes in four different colors
- Includes free carry bag
- Quick dry
Cons
- Expensive
- Stains and dust accumulate easily
3. Best Extra-Long: Lululemon The Reversible (Big) Mat 5mm
Highlights:
Reversible
- Material– Natural Rubber, synthetic rubber, nylon, and polyester
- Thickness– 5 millimeters
- Dimensions– 84 x 28 inches
- Weight– 7.05 pounds
Description:
As the name suggests, this mat is extra long, making it one of the best yoga mats for taller individuals. It is one of the most oversized mats with a length of 84 inches and a width of 28 inches. The 5-millimeter thickness provides a fine cushion.
The mat is also reversible. One of the sides is made of polyurethane, and the other side is made of rubber. The polyurethane side provides a better grip. The rubber side isn’t bad either if you don’t mind the rubber smell.
Pros
- Large in size
- Reversible
- Good thickness
- Quick-drying on the polyurethane side
Cons
- The rubber side has poor grip
- Quite heavy
4. Jade Yoga Harmony Yoga Mat
Highlights:
Quick dry
- Material– Rubber
- Thickness– 4.7 millimeters
- Dimensions– 173 x 61 x 0.5 centimeters
- Weight– 4.8 pounds
Description:
If you are into hot yoga or sweat a lot, the Jade Yoga Harmony Yoga mat is a perfect choice. The mat is made of natural rubber, which absorbs the mixture quickly and keeps the mat dry at all times.
The 5-millimeter thickness provides optimum cushion, and the weight is just under 5 pounds. That means the mat isn’t too heavy. It is also easy to roll up and carry, making it great for travel.
Pros:
- Quick dry
- Available in many colors
- Easy to roll
- Available in two different lengths
Cons
- Has a lingering rubber smell

9. Gaiam Sol Studio Select Dry-Grip Yoga Mat
Highlights:
Dry Grip
- Material– Polyvinyl Chloride
- Thickness– 5mm
- Dimensions– 68-Inch x 24-inch x 5mm
- Weight– 3.85 pounds
Description:
If you want a relatively lightweight and latex-free mat, go for the Select Dry-Grip Yoga Mat by Gaiam Sol Studio. The mat has a thickness of 5mmm, which makes for a wonderful cushioning.
The material is PVC, which makes the mat relatively light. The use of PVC makes it an excellent choice if you have a latex allergy or dislike the smell of rubber. In addition, it makes the mat odor-free and germ-free. The mat also keeps dry and is not problematic even if you sweat profusely during those lengthy yoga sessions.
Pros
- Good grip
- Has two color options
- Relatively light
- Latex and rubber free
Cons
- Relatively costly
- Not very durable
